Abstract:
A constricting clutch brake element is operable to selectively transmit mechanical power between relatively movable rotating members. A plurality of backing plates are movably mounted and selectively movable radially on an annular body of the clutch brake element. The backing plates engage a plurality of friction linings. Each backing plate is configured for usage with different numbers of torques bars to meet different torque carrying capacities, all within the same envelope size. The configuration also allows plural torque bars to be relatively positioned so that they can engagingly guide the backing plate during its radial movement.
Abstract:
A multiple natural frequency coupling apparatus for connecting a rotatable driving member to a rotatable driven member of a drive line. The coupling apparatus of the present invention provides a substantially cylindrical housing having a longitudinal axis with a substantially cylindrical outer shaft coaxially aligned with and connected to the housing. A substantially cylindrical inner shaft is coaxially aligned with the outer shaft and the housing. A substantially cylindrical chuck housing is coaxially aligned with the housing, the outer shaft, and the inner shaft wherein the fluid chuck housing is connected to the inner shaft. A substantially cylindrical collapsible sleeve is coaxially aligned with and between the fluid chuck housing and the outer shaft, wherein the collapsible sleeve may move between a non-actuated position, wherein the collapsible sleeve does not engage the outer shaft thereby providing the coupling apparatus with a first torsional stiffness corresponding to a first natural frequency, and an actuated position, wherein the collapsible sleeve engages the outer shaft thereby providing the coupling apparatus with a second torsional stiffness corresponding to a second natural frequency.
Abstract:
A constricting clutch brake element (10) is operative to selectively transmit mechanical power between relatively movable rotating members. A plurality of backing plates (38) releasibly engage a plurality of friction linings (34). The friction linings are selectively moved radially to operatively engage annular body (12) and a central rotating member (26). The friction linings are releasibly engaged with corresponding backing plates (38) through interengaging ear portions (52) of the lining and slots (62) of the backing plates.

Abstract:
There is provided a torque limiter in which oil in an oil pressure expanding chamber can be rapidly removed, when an inner peripheral face of a tube member has slipped with respect to an outer peripheral face of a shaft member, and burn-outs are unlikely to occur on the shaft member and the tube member.An area of a region where an inner face of a circumferentially extending chamber 38 intersects an oil pressure expanding chamber 26 in an extended plane extended toward the oil pressure expanding chamber 26 is made larger than a sectional area of an opening of an oil removing hole which is opened to the circumferentially extending chamber 38.
Abstract:
A torque limiter includes a shaft member 1 and a cylinder member 2. An oil-seal preventing groove 35 opened on axial both sides of the shaft member 1 is formed in an outer circumferential surface 20 of the shaft member 1 to be frictionally coupled to an inner circumferential surface 21 of the cylinder member 2 in torque transmission.
Abstract:
A coupling assembly component includes an annular base. A first annular friction surface is connected with the base and is movable into engagement with a second annular friction surface. An annular fluid extensible tube is inflatable to move the first friction surface into engagement with the second friction surface. A fitting is connected with the base and the tube to conduct fluid pressure into a chamber in the tube. An annular mounting ring is disposed in a coaxial relationship with the base and the tube. The annular mounting ring is embedded in the tube and is connected with a portion of the fitting. The annular mounting ring may be provided with only a single opening which is connected with a fitting through which fluid is conducted into the tube. However, the annular mounting ring may be provided with a plurality of openings connected with a plurality of fittings.
Abstract:
A revolving force transmission/revolution stopping device which supports rotatably one of two shafts or both and connects/disconnects a revolving force of one of the two shafts to/from the other or stops one of the shafts from revolving. At least a portion of one of the two shafts is in the form of a hollow cylinder while the other shaft is at least partially inserted in the hollow cylindrical portion, either of the two shafts is provided with a member inflatable when supplied with a fluid, a passage for supply and discharge of the fluid is formed in the shaft having the inflatable member, and the inflatable member, when inflated by the supplied fluid, catches the shaft with no such inflatable member or is forced to the hollow inner circumferential surface of the cylindrical portion.

Abstract:
A method is disclosed for converting a mechanically-actuated drive unit to an air-actuated drive unit (18) in an industrial power transmission system of the type having a short-shaft motorized input drive employing an input shaft (16) releasably connected to an output shaft (20) by the drive unit. A spider (14, 42) having a hub (50) is affixed to the input shaft. The drive unit has an input member (86) connected to a radial flange (68) of the spider and an output member (92) connected to the output shaft. The drive unit includes an actuator member (88) for releasing and connecting the input and output members. In the method, the mechanically-actuated drive unit is replaced with the air-actuated drive unit. A diameter of the spider hub is reduced and a rotary air seal adaptor (12) is affixed directly onto the reduced diameter spider hub. The rotary air seal adaptor has a stationary air chamber member (28) for receiving air from an external air supply source and an air chamber passageway (28a) for carrying said air.
